The aim of this webinar is to discuss issues associated with the aggregate compensation and commercial reasonableness of physician arrangements. As healthcare regulations continue to evolve, these two elements must be carefully reviewed by counsel and appraisers to ensure compliance. With recent litigation and DOJ settlements, health systems continue to take notice of the significant risk associated with this area of focus. There will also be a discussion on regulatory background, recent settlements, areas of risk, key items for review, and assessment tools.
